Please note that the cooking time will depend on your microwave wattage. Every microwave is different, so it may take a couple of tries for you to get the cooking time just right without overcooking it. Mine took about 1:50 minutes to cook, yours may take 1:30 or 2 minutes. Warning: if you overcook this it will turn rubbery! When it’s ready, it will be firm but springy to the touch.

How To Make It: Chocolate Brownie Mug Cake

A quick fix for chocolate cravings ready in 4 minutes. This chocolate brownie mug cake is easy to make, moist, rich and fudgy.
I used a 80z (225 g) mug

Ingredients

  • ¼ cup (30 g) all-purpose flour
  • 3 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 2 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
  • ¼ teaspoon baking powder
  • a pinch of salt
  • ¼ cup +1 tablespoon (75 ml) milk I used skim milk
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la essence
  • Toppings (optional) : caramel sauce, chocolate syrup, ice cream, chopped nuts, chocolate shavings, etc..,

Instructions

  • In a microwave-safe mug whisk together the fl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king powder and salt until well combined.
  • Add the milk, vegetable oil and vanilla. Whisk well to combine and make sure you have incorporated all the flour off the bottom of the mug.
  • Microwave on high for about 1 minute and 20 seconds (*Please check notes) or until the cake is firm but springy to the touch. Do NOT over-bake!
  • Let it cool for a couple of minutes, add your favorite toppings and serve!

Notes

*Cooking time will depend on your microwave wattage. Mine took about 1:50 minutes to cook, yours may take 1:30 or 2 minutes. When it’s ready, it will be firm but springy to the touch.
